TLC Sets Premiere Date for 'What Not to Wear'
7:55 AM PDT 7/26/2011 by Lindsay Powers
The network has also announced a few changes to its longest-running primetime series.
TLC has announced a few changes for its longest running primetime series, What Not to Wear, which returns Aug. 16 at 9 p.m. ET for its ninth season.
The first episode features Dancing With the Stars' Cheryl Burke and Jenny McCarthy, who ask show hosts Stacy London and Clinton Kelly to makeover their assistant, Becky.
The show will also debut a renovated studio and new 360 mirror.
New this season as well: Stacy and Clinton will also follow up with each person they've made over two weeks later to see how it's affected their lives and if they've kept up with their new looks.
What Not to Wear is produced by BBC Productions for TLC.
